Global sheet metal fabrication services

According to ResearchAndMarkets.com's “Sheet Metal Fabrication Services Market: Global Industry Analysis, Trends, Market Size, and Forecasts up to 2024”, the global sheet metal fabrication services market is set to grow with a CAGR of 1.5% from 2018-2024.

The study on the sheet metal fabrication services market covers North America, Europe, Asia-Pacific and RoW from 2016 to 2024, providing qualitative and quantitative analysis over that period. 

Market drivers, said the report, include the increasing use of ready to fix fabrication products; the growth in investments in aerospace, automotive, construction and defence industries and the fact that automation is reducing human intervention in metal cutting. It also flags opportunities such as the emergence of advanced 3D printing/additive manufacturing technologies and wide-bodied commercial and defence aircraft.
